Exploring Pyrolysis Nanotechnology: Advancements and Applications


Introduction: In recent years, pyrolysis nanotechnology has emerged as a promising field with numerous applications in various industries. This advanced process involves the decomposition of organic materials at high temperatures in the absence of oxygen, resulting in the production of valuable nanomaterials. In this blog post, we will delve deeper into the world of pyrolysis nanotechnology, exploring its advancements and highlighting its diverse applications.
1. Understanding Pyrolysis Nanotechnology: Pyrolysis nanotechnology involves the use of advanced thermal decomposition techniques to break down organic materials into smaller, nanoscale particles. The process typically takes place in a controlled environment, such as a reactor chamber, where the absence of oxygen prevents combustion and results in the formation of unique nanomaterials.
2. Advancements in Pyrolysis Nanotechnology: a) Control over Nanoparticle Size and Shape: Researchers have made significant progress in controlling the size and shape of nanoparticles produced through pyrolysis. This ability opens up a wide range of possibilities for tailoring materials with specific properties for various applications.
b) Novel Nanomaterial Synthesis: Pyrolysis nanotechnology has enabled the synthesis of new and advanced nanomaterials, such as carbon nanotubes, graphene, metal nanoparticles, and carbon-based nanocomposites. These materials exhibit exceptional properties, including high conductivity, mechanical strength, and catalytic activity.
c) Scalability and Cost-effectiveness: With the development of efficient pyrolysis reactors and continuous processing methods, the scalability of pyrolysis nanotechnology has been significantly improved. This advancement allows for large-scale production of nanomaterials, making them more accessible and cost-effective for different industries.
3. Applications of Pyrolysis Nanotechnology: a) Energy Storage and Conversion: Pyrolysis-derived nanomaterials, such as carbon nanotubes and graphene-based composites, have been extensively studied for their applications in energy storage and conversion devices. These materials exhibit high electrochemical performance, making them suitable for supercapacitors, lithium-ion batteries, and fuel cells.
b) Environmental Remediation: Pyrolysis nanotechnology has shown promise in environmental remediation applications, particularly for the removal of heavy metals and organic pollutants from wastewater. Nanomaterials derived from pyrolysis processes can efficiently adsorb and catalytically degrade contaminants, providing a sustainable solution for water treatment.
c) Advanced Functional Materials: The unique properties of pyrolysis-derived nanomaterials make them ideal candidates for advanced functional materials. These materials find applications in various fields, including electronics, catalysts, sensors, and biomedical devices.
Conclusion: Pyrolysis nanotechnology is revolutionizing the production of nanomaterials with its scalable and controllable synthesis methods. The advancements in this field have paved the way for various applications in energy storage, environmental remediation, and advanced functional materials. As researchers continue to explore the potential of pyrolysis nanotechnology, we can expect further breakthroughs that will shape the future of numerous industries.
